   ### What changed
   
   Fixes #38770
   
   This fixes handling of `num_storage_api_streams` / `num_streams` for 
BigQuery Storage Write API batch writes.
   
   Previously, the Java schema transform only applied `num_streams` inside the 
unbounded pipeline branch, so bounded batch pipelines using the Storage Write 
API ignored the configured fixed stream count. This change applies 
`withNumStorageWriteApiStreams(...)` whenever `num_streams > 0`, while keeping 
triggering frequency and auto-sharding behavior limited to unbounded pipelines.
   
   ### Details
   
   * Applies fixed Storage Write API stream counts to bounded and unbounded 
schema transform writes.
   * Keeps `auto_sharding` as an unbounded-only option.
   * Removes outdated documentation that described `num_storage_api_streams` / 
`num_streams` as streaming-only.
   * Updates Java, Python, and website docs to reflect batch support.
   * Adds a bounded pipeline translation test that verifies fixed stream counts 
produce the expected batch redistribute step.
